Abstract

A method and an apparatus for named entity recognition, and a non-transitory computer-readable recording medium are provided. In the method, text elements are traversed according to a text span to obtain candidate entity words. Then, a class to which the candidate entity word belongs is recognized. The recognizing of the class includes generating a prompt template corresponding to the candidate entity word, and concatenating the text to be recognized and the prompt template to obtain a concatenated text; generating vector representations of the text elements in the concatenated text; generating the vector representation of the candidate entity word according to the vector representations of the text elements of each candidate entity word in the concatenated text, and the vector representation of the text element of the mask word; and classifying the vector representation of the candidate entity word to obtain the class of the candidate entity word.
